Set WordPerfect as the default MEX application

Change the default app that opens a file on Mac

  1. Right-click or use Control + Left-click on the desired MEX file to open a menu where you can choose from multiple actions;
  2. Choose "Open in Application" and click "Other";
  3. Look at the bottom of the window, where you will see the "Enable" menu. "Recommended Programs" will be selected as the default option;
  4. Within this menu select "All Programs" and navigate to WordPerfect. Check the box next to "Always open in app" to make sure it’s the default option.

Change default programs in Windows

  1. Start the process by right-clicking on your MEX file and selecting "Open With". From there, click "Choose another app" to continue;
  2. From the options listed in the pop-up window, specifically choose WordPerfect as the application to handle your MEX file;
  3. Be sure to check the "Always use this app" checkbox and click "OK" to save your preference.
